Rework is the enemy of smart project management.

Picture this: You're deep into construction, ceilings are going in, paint is scheduled. Then someone realizes the speaker infrastructure was never planned. Now you're looking at opening finished walls, delaying timelines, and those tough budget conversations.

Here's what rework actually costs:
• Labor to physically undo completed work
• Additional materials for infrastructure that should have been planned
• Project delays, even with overtime
• Potential scope cuts if costs climb too high

The fix? Bring your low voltage partner in during design development, minimum. Better yet, get them involved during programming and schematic design. When your AV team is coordinating with architects, MEP, and the entire design group from the start, you're catching conflicts before walls go up, not after.

When AV partners are brought in late, even the best-laid plans can unravel. Marques Manning recently shared the reality: custom ceilings, already installed, had to be cut open just to add the infrastructure omitted in early designs—a costly fix with ripples across schedule, budget, and future operations.

Leaving AV coordination to the end of the process often means:
• Redesign and demolition of finished spaces
• Rapid cost escalation and labor strain
• Tough decisions about scaling back your original vision
• Operational headaches for years to come
• Legacy that reflects missed opportunities instead of leadership foresight

At KONTEK, we believe a truly intuitive system means no manuals, no questions—just immediate confidence. Our team’s disciplined approach is driven by empathy: even technology-averse users should feel completely at ease. When system design is done right, the only thing you prepare for is your meeting, not the equipment.

Crafting this level of simplicity takes expertise and humility. We channel deep technical skill into solutions that remove friction at every touchpoint.

Our approach includes:
• Limiting actions to two or three clear button presses
• Designing interface elements that always look and feel actionable
• Calibrating every step toward user confidence and familiarity
• Routinely checking in to ensure lasting support and trust
